Essay Topics

Write an essay for ONE of the following topics:

Essay Topic 1

Analyze the hills as a setting in this novel. How does this setting affect the characters and the plot? Define setting in your analysis and give examples from the novel.

Essay Topic 2

How is the theme of family explored in this novel? Define theme in your discussion and use quotes or examples from the book to support your statements.

Essay Topic 3

Follow the development of David's character throughout this novel. What things are most significant in his development? Why? Give examples of David's character development from the novel with examples and quotes.
